Berry Motor Car Service Building
The Berry Motor Car Service Building, at 2220 Washington Ave in St. Louis, Missouri, was built in 1937.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2010.Photo: Nyttend, Public domain.

Energizer Park
Stadium
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Energizer Park, previously CityPark, is a 22,423-seat soccer-specific stadium in St. Louis, Missouri, United States. It is the home of St. Louis City SC, the city's Major League Soccer franchise. Energizer Park is situated 1,200 feet south of Berry Motor Car Service Building.
Enterprise Center
Stadium
Photo: Haaron755,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Enterprise Center is an 18,096-seat arena located in downtown St. Louis, Missouri, United States. Its primary tenant is the St. Louis Blues of the National Hockey League, but it is also used for other functions, such as NCAA basketball, NCAA hockey, concerts, professional wrestling and more. Enterprise Center is situated 3,700 feet southeast of Berry Motor Car Service Building.
Scott Joplin House State Historic Site
Museum
Photo: kevinsaff,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Scott Joplin House State Historic Site is located at 2658 Delmar Boulevard in St. Louis, Missouri. It preserves the Scott Joplin Residence, the home of composer Scott Joplin from 1901 to 1903. Scott Joplin House State Historic Site is situated 1,400 feet northwest of Berry Motor Car Service Building.

Carr Square
Neighborhood
Photo: Paul Sableman, CC BY 2.0.
Carr Square is a neighborhood of St. Louis, Missouri. The neighborhood is bounded by Cass Avenue on the north, Carr Street on the south, North Tucker Boulevard and North 13th Street on the east, and North Jefferson on the west.
Midtown St. Louis
Neighborhood
Midtown is a neighborhood in St. Louis, Missouri. It is located 3 miles west of the city riverfront at the intersection of Grand and Lindell Boulevards. It is home to the campus of Saint Louis University.
